Skip to main content
    Skip to main contentSkip to navigationSkip to footer
    Technology

    BM25 Ranking

    Updated: 2/12/2026

    BM25 is a classic lexical ranking function used in information retrieval that scores documents based on term frequency, inverse document frequency, and length normalization.

    Quick Summary

    If you build search/RAG systems, BM25 is a "must-know" because it often improves retrieval for acronyms, IDs, and rare jargon—exactly what technical users query.

    Explanation

    BM25 is often the baseline for keyword search. In modern RAG, BM25 is frequently combined with embeddings in hybrid retrieval to handle both exact terms and semantic matches.

    Marketing Relevance

    If you build search/RAG systems, BM25 is a "must-know" because it often improves retrieval for acronyms, IDs, and rare jargon—exactly what technical users query.

    Example

    Searching for "HNSW efSearch" is better handled by BM25 than pure vector similarity because the exact token matters.

    Common Pitfalls

    Over-reliance on lexical matching (misses semantic paraphrases); not tuning fields; ignoring dedupe/boilerplate; treating BM25 scores as calibrated confidence.

    Origin & History

    BM25 Ranking has become an established concept in the field of Technology. With the rise of modern AI systems, the broad availability of large language models such as GPT-5 and Claude 4.6, and the growing data-orientation in marketing, BM25 Ranking has gained significant traction since 2023. Today, organisations across DACH and globally rely on BM25 Ranking to scale marketing operations, accelerate decision-making, and build a competitive edge through automated, data-driven workflows.

    Marketing Use Cases

    1

    Engineering teams integrate BM25 Ranking into existing MarTech stacks via APIs and webhooks without ripping out legacy systems.

    2

    Platform teams use BM25 Ranking as a building block for scalable, multi-tenant architectures with clear data governance.

    3

    DevOps and platform engineering teams automate deployment pipelines, monitoring and incident response with BM25 Ranking.

    4

    Security leads adopt BM25 Ranking to centralise access, auditing and compliance reporting.

    5

    Solution architects evaluate BM25 Ranking as part of buy-vs-build decisions for marketing technology.

    6

    IT leadership anchors BM25 Ranking in the roadmap to drive down total cost of ownership and avoid vendor lock-in over time.

    Frequently Asked Questions

    What is BM25 Ranking?

    BM25 is a classic lexical ranking function used in information retrieval that scores documents based on term frequency, inverse document frequency, and length normalization. In the context of Technology, BM25 Ranking describes an established approach increasingly used in production by AI-marketing teams to lift efficiency and quality in a measurable way.

    Why does BM25 Ranking matter for marketing teams in 2026?

    If you build search/RAG systems, BM25 is a "must-know" because it often improves retrieval for acronyms, IDs, and rare jargon—exactly what technical users query. Companies that introduce BM25 Ranking in a structured way typically report 20–40% efficiency gains within the first 6 months.

    How do I introduce BM25 Ranking in my company?

    A pragmatic rollout of BM25 Ranking starts with a clearly scoped pilot use case, sharp KPIs (e.g. time, cost or conversion impact), a cross-functional team across marketing, data and IT, and a governance baseline aligned with EU AI Act and GDPR. After 6–8 weeks, scale to additional use cases.

    What are the risks and pitfalls of BM25 Ranking?

    Common pitfalls of BM25 Ranking include vague target outcomes, weak data quality, low team adoption, and bringing privacy and compliance in too late. A structured readiness check, clear ownership and a realistic roadmap materially reduce these risks.

    Related Services

    Related Terms

    👋Questions? Chat with us!